updates for OpenVMS compile support

git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@51161 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
This commit is contained in:
Jouk Jansen 2008-01-11 12:31:03 +00:00
parent f2a0f3a80b
commit 2395c7a18b
5 changed files with 30 additions and 13 deletions

View File

@ -439,6 +439,11 @@ typedef pid_t GPid;
#define wxUSE_VALIDATORS 1 #define wxUSE_VALIDATORS 1
#ifdef __WXMSW__
#define wxUSE_AUTOID_MANAGEMENT 0
#else
#define wxUSE_AUTOID_MANAGEMENT 0
#endif
#define wxUSE_COMMON_DIALOGS 1 #define wxUSE_COMMON_DIALOGS 1
@ -1230,4 +1235,5 @@ typedef pid_t GPid;
#undef HAVE_SYS_SELECT_H #undef HAVE_SYS_SELECT_H
#endif /* __WX_SETUP_H__ */ #endif /* __WX_SETUP_H__ */

View File

@ -2,7 +2,7 @@
# * # *
# Make file for VMS * # Make file for VMS *
# Author : J.Jansen (joukj@hrem.nano.tudelft.nl) * # Author : J.Jansen (joukj@hrem.nano.tudelft.nl) *
# Date : 26 November 2007 * # Date : 10 January 2008 *
# * # *
#***************************************************************************** #*****************************************************************************
.first .first
@ -207,7 +207,8 @@ OBJECTS2=tbarbase.obj,srchcmn.obj,\
filepickercmn.obj,\ filepickercmn.obj,\
fontpickercmn.obj,\ fontpickercmn.obj,\
pickerbase.obj,\ pickerbase.obj,\
listctrlcmn.obj listctrlcmn.obj,gsocketiohandler.obj,fdiodispatcher.obj,\
selectdispatcher.obj,overlaycmn.obj,windowid.obj
OBJECTS_MOTIF=radiocmn.obj,combocmn.obj OBJECTS_MOTIF=radiocmn.obj,combocmn.obj
@ -217,8 +218,6 @@ OBJECTS_X11=accesscmn.obj,dndcmn.obj,dpycmn.obj,dseldlg.obj,\
regex.obj,taskbarcmn.obj,xti.obj,xtistrm.obj,xtixml.obj,\ regex.obj,taskbarcmn.obj,xti.obj,xtistrm.obj,xtixml.obj,\
combocmn.obj combocmn.obj
OBJECTS_X11_2=gsocketiohandler.obj,fdiodispatcher.obj,selectdispatcher.obj
OBJECTS_GTK2=fontutilcmn.obj,cairo.obj OBJECTS_GTK2=fontutilcmn.obj,cairo.obj
@ -326,6 +325,7 @@ SOURCES = \
mstream.cpp,\ mstream.cpp,\
nbkbase.cpp,\ nbkbase.cpp,\
object.cpp,\ object.cpp,\
overlaycmn.cpp,\
paper.cpp,\ paper.cpp,\
platinfo.cpp,\ platinfo.cpp,\
popupcmn.cpp,\ popupcmn.cpp,\
@ -432,17 +432,22 @@ all : $(SOURCES)
.else .else
.ifdef __WXX11__ .ifdef __WXX11__
$(MMS)$(MMSQUALIFIERS) $(OBJECTS_X11) $(MMS)$(MMSQUALIFIERS) $(OBJECTS_X11)
$(MMS)$(MMSQUALIFIERS) $(OBJECTS_X11_2)
library [--.lib]libwx_x11_univ.olb $(OBJECTS) library [--.lib]libwx_x11_univ.olb $(OBJECTS)
library [--.lib]libwx_x11_univ.olb $(OBJECTS1) library [--.lib]libwx_x11_univ.olb $(OBJECTS1)
library [--.lib]libwx_x11_univ.olb $(OBJECTS2) library [--.lib]libwx_x11_univ.olb $(OBJECTS2)
library [--.lib]libwx_x11_univ.olb $(OBJECTS_X11) library [--.lib]libwx_x11_univ.olb $(OBJECTS_X11)
library [--.lib]libwx_x11_univ.olb $(OBJECTS_X11_2)
.endif .endif
.endif .endif
.endif .endif
.endif .endif
$(OBJECTS) : [--.include.wx]setup.h
$(OBJECTS1) : [--.include.wx]setup.h
$(OBJECTS2) : [--.include.wx]setup.h
$(OBJECTS_X11) : [--.include.wx]setup.h
$(OBJECTS_GTK2) : [--.include.wx]setup.h
$(OBJECTS_MOTIF) : [--.include.wx]setup.h
accelcmn.obj : accelcmn.cpp accelcmn.obj : accelcmn.cpp
anidecod.obj : anidecod.cpp anidecod.obj : anidecod.cpp
animatecmn.obj : animatecmn.cpp animatecmn.obj : animatecmn.cpp
@ -623,3 +628,5 @@ srchcmn.obj : srchcmn.cpp
textentrycmn.obj : textentrycmn.cpp textentrycmn.obj : textentrycmn.cpp
filectrlcmn.obj : filectrlcmn.cpp filectrlcmn.obj : filectrlcmn.cpp
cairo.obj : cairo.cpp cairo.obj : cairo.cpp
overlaycmn.obj : overlaycmn.cpp
windowid.obj : windowid.cpp

View File

@ -2,7 +2,7 @@
# * # *
# Make file for VMS * # Make file for VMS *
# Author : J.Jansen (joukj@hrem.nano.tudelft.nl) * # Author : J.Jansen (joukj@hrem.nano.tudelft.nl) *
# Date : 20 December 2007 * # Date : 3 January 2008 *
# * # *
#***************************************************************************** #*****************************************************************************
.first .first
@ -164,8 +164,7 @@ SOURCES = \
.ifdef __WXMOTIF__ .ifdef __WXMOTIF__
OBJECTS0=statusbr.obj,statline.obj,notebook.obj,spinctlg.obj,collpaneg.obj,\ OBJECTS0=statusbr.obj,statline.obj,notebook.obj,spinctlg.obj,collpaneg.obj,\
combog.obj,animateg.obj,colrdlgg.obj,clrpickerg.obj,fontpickerg.obj,\ combog.obj,animateg.obj,colrdlgg.obj,clrpickerg.obj,fontpickerg.obj
paletteg.obj
.else .else
.ifdef __WXX11__ .ifdef __WXX11__
OBJECTS0=accel.obj,filedlgg.obj,dragimgg.obj,fdrepdlg.obj,htmllbox.obj,\ OBJECTS0=accel.obj,filedlgg.obj,dragimgg.obj,fdrepdlg.obj,htmllbox.obj,\

View File

@ -2,7 +2,7 @@
# * # *
# Make file for VMS * # Make file for VMS *
# Author : J.Jansen (joukj@hrem.nano.tudelft.nl) * # Author : J.Jansen (joukj@hrem.nano.tudelft.nl) *
# Date : 22 September 2006 * # Date : 4 January 2008 *
# * # *
#***************************************************************************** #*****************************************************************************
.first .first
@ -106,6 +106,8 @@ all : $(SOURCES)
$(MMS)$(MMSQUALIFIERS) $(OBJECTS) $(MMS)$(MMSQUALIFIERS) $(OBJECTS)
library [--.lib]libwx_x11_univ.olb $(OBJECTS) library [--.lib]libwx_x11_univ.olb $(OBJECTS)
$(OBJECTS) : [--.include.wx]setup.h
bmpbuttn.obj : bmpbuttn.cpp bmpbuttn.obj : bmpbuttn.cpp
button.obj : button.cpp button.obj : button.cpp
checkbox.obj : checkbox.cpp checkbox.obj : checkbox.cpp
@ -141,7 +143,7 @@ winuniv.obj : winuniv.cpp
combobox.obj : combobox.cpp combobox.obj : combobox.cpp
ctrlrend.obj : ctrlrend.cpp ctrlrend.obj : ctrlrend.cpp
gtk.obj : [.themes]gtk.cpp gtk.obj : [.themes]gtk.cpp
cxx $(CXXFLAGS)$(CXX_DEFINE) [.themes]gtk.cpp cxx $(CXXFLAGS)$(CXX_DEFINE)/object=gtk.obj [.themes]gtk.cpp
metal.obj : [.themes]metal.cpp metal.obj : [.themes]metal.cpp
cxx $(CXXFLAGS)$(CXX_DEFINE) [.themes]metal.cpp cxx $(CXXFLAGS)$(CXX_DEFINE) [.themes]metal.cpp
radiobox.obj : radiobox.cpp radiobox.obj : radiobox.cpp

View File

@ -2,7 +2,7 @@
# * # *
# Make file for VMS * # Make file for VMS *
# Author : J.Jansen (joukj@hrem.nano.tudelft.nl) * # Author : J.Jansen (joukj@hrem.nano.tudelft.nl) *
# Date : 3 January 2007 * # Date : 3 January 2008 *
# * # *
#***************************************************************************** #*****************************************************************************
.first .first
@ -34,6 +34,7 @@ OBJECTS = \
bitmap.obj,\ bitmap.obj,\
brush.obj,\ brush.obj,\
glcanvas.obj,\ glcanvas.obj,\
palette.obj,\
pen.obj,\ pen.obj,\
region.obj,\ region.obj,\
utilsx.obj utilsx.obj
@ -46,7 +47,6 @@ OBJECTS_X11=app.obj,dc.obj,\
font.obj,\ font.obj,\
minifram.obj,\ minifram.obj,\
nanox.obj,\ nanox.obj,\
palette.obj,\
popupwin.obj,\ popupwin.obj,\
reparent.obj,\ reparent.obj,\
settings.obj,\ settings.obj,\
@ -101,6 +101,9 @@ all : $(SOURCES)
.endif .endif
.endif .endif
$(OBJECTS) : [--.include.wx]setup.h
$(OBJECTS_X11) : [--.include.wx]setup.h
bitmap.obj : bitmap.cpp bitmap.obj : bitmap.cpp
brush.obj : brush.cpp brush.obj : brush.cpp
glcanvas.obj : glcanvas.cpp glcanvas.obj : glcanvas.cpp